Transaction 682e2fbaba4bd7a1f94448c17d6b32e4b3eadda76155710a158154f4c02e9167
1 Input
1 Output
-
682e2fbaba4bd7a1f94448c17d6b32e4b3eadda76155710a158154f4c02e9167:0
- value
- 290547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b6ac5e760979cc1980ee32ea802343b0bcceafb OP_EQUAL
- address
- 3EQBkvvhpyfNwad9ECGdd31yP4uwoqxPWF